Vaping vapor is primarily composed of propylene glycol (PG), vegetable glycerin (VG), nicotine, and flavorings suspended in water vapor. While it is less corrosive than cigarette smoke, residual vapor can settle on surfaces, including electronic components. Over time, the glycerin in vapor can create a sticky film, potentially affecting sensitive electronics like charging ports or circuit boards if exposed repeatedly. However, this risk is minimal with proper care—such as keeping devices clean and avoiding direct vapor contact. For vape mods, which are designed for vaping use, modern devices often feature protective coatings to handle moisture exposure, making them durable for daily use.
